Ströer launches wide-coverage, multi-screen moving-image marketing with Ströer Primetime

Ströer launches wide-coverage, multi-screen moving-image marketing with Ströer Primetime

Unternehmen 09. September 2013

At dmexco, Ströer is launching an exclusive new marketer: Ströer Primetime. The new marketer unites moving-image advertising on private screens (smartphones and tablets), home screens (PC), and public screens (DOOH displays) within the Ströer Digital Group. Ströer Digital will be no. 1 in terms of reach based on new AGOF currency

Ströer Digital will be no. 1 in terms of reach based on new AGOF currency

Unternehmen 21. September 2015

The German competition authority Bundeskartellamt approved the acquisition of Germany’s largest internet portal, t-online.de, and the country’s biggest digital marketer, InteractiveMedia, according to AGOF Digital Facts, without any restrictions.
